DEFEAT OF STATE CABINET

POLITICAL CRISIS IN ADELAIDE IMPROVED DOMESTIC OUTLOOK United Press Association —Bv Electric Telegraph—Copyright ADELAIDE, October 7. The Hill Government was defeated In the Assembly, by 27 to 16, when the Leader of the Opposition, Mr R. L. Butler was successful in having progress imported on the Wheat Storage Bill. Mr Hill earlier threatened that the Government would have seriously to consider its position if the Bill introduced by the Leader of the Opposition as a private measure was passed. State Finances. In the Assembly, Mr Hill stated that the estimated revenue for 1932-33 was £10,056,807, and the estimated expenditure £11,244.300, the estimated deficit being £I.IP* 7 493, comp^ - ' £1,063,360 last year. The unemployment position had saown a inprovement, and the seasonal outlook was encouraging, and there was every prospect of a record wheat harvest. CHANGES IN FEDERAL CABINET. PLANS TO FILL VACANCIES. United Press Association —By Electric Telegraph—Conyrlght (Received October 7, 7.45 p.m.) CANBERRA, October 7. Unofficial negotiations are going on with the Country Party, concerning the two vacancies in the Federal Cabinet, due to the resignations of Mr Hawker and Mr Fenton, and it is understood that there is a possibility of that party being represented in Cabinet.

An announcement is expected after the week-end.
